#5118f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5118f5 is composed of 31.8% red, 9.4%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.9% cyan, 90.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 255.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 52.7%. #5118f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#a230ff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

#5118f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5118f5 has RGB values of R:81, G:24,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5314805.

Shades and Tints of #5118f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04010d is the darkest color, while #fbf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5118f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827e8f is the less saturated color, while #4d0ffe is the most saturated one.
